1. What are some key parameters of energy storage systems? Rated power is the total possible instantaneous discharge capacity of the system, usually in kilowatts (kW) or megawatts (MW). Energy is the maximum energy stored (power rate in a given time), usually described in kilowatt-hours (kWh) or megawatt-hours (MWH).
